用GDB调试程序

来源:互联网 发布:彩票算法大揭密 编辑:程序博客网 时间:2024/05/21 21:44

陈皓专栏 【空谷幽兰,心如皓月】  看到的系列文章,贴个链接过来收藏。(版权归原作者陈皓所有)


用GDB调试程序(一)
    GDB概述
   
一个调试示例
   
使用GDB
用GDB调试程序(二)
    GDB的命令概貌
   
GDB中运行UNIX的shell程序
   
在GDB中运行程序
   
调试已运行的程序
   
暂停 / 恢复程序运行
      
一、设置断点(BreakPoint)
      
二、设置观察点(WatchPoint)
      
三、设置捕捉点(CatchPoint)
用GDB调试程序(三)
       四、维护停止点
      
五、停止条件维护
      
六、为停止点设定运行命令
      
七、断点菜单
      
八、恢复程序运行和单步调试
      
九、信号(Signals)
      
十、线程(Thread Stops)
用GDB调试程序(四)
    查看栈信息
   
查看源程序
      
一、显示源代码
      
二、搜索源代码
      
三、指定源文件的路径
      
四、源代码的内存
用GDB调试程序(五)
    查看运行时数据
      
一、表达式
      
二、程序变量
      
三、数组
      
四、输出格式
      
五、查看内存
      
六、自动显示
用GDB调试程序(六)
       七、设置显示选项
      
八、历史记录
      
九、GDB环境变量
      
十、查看寄存器
用GDB调试程序(七)
    改变程序的执行
      
一、修改变量值
      
二、跳转执行
      
三、产生信号量
      
四、强制函数返回
      
五、强制调用函数
   
在不同语言中使用GDB
   
后记    
原创粉丝点击